Description:
-
WI An exploration of the purposeful use of mixed materials for visual and conceptual expression. Students create two- and/or three-dimensional artwork using wet, dry, natural and manmade materials. Students increase skills related to congruities in content and materials, composition, personal style and preference. Students learn to articulate their ideas and expand their understanding of the basic elements of art. A&L
